    What is Dr. Oran Berkenstock's specialty?

    Dr. Berkenstock is a Hospitalist near Knoxville, TN. Hospitalists are physicians dedicated primarily to the general medical care of hospitalized patients. Their roles encompass patient care, education, research, and leadership within the field of Hospital Medicine.     Is this Dr. Oran Berkenstock affiliated with a ranked Castle Connolly Top Hospital?

    Yes, Dr. Berkenstock is affiliated with Baptist Memorial Hospital-Memphis which is a Castle Connolly Top Hospital.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als are healthcare institutions recognized for their excellence in specific medical procedures and overall patient care. They are identified through a rigorous peer nomination process, evaluating factors like patient outcomes, quality of care, and expertise.
